Uobičajeni pristup je ignoriranje Versioniranja kada je to moguće, kao što je kada API služi internom klijentu. … Odluka o verziji ili ne svodi se na izbor i potrebu programera, ali Vester savjetuje da odustane od verzije vašeg API-ja osim ako je apsolutno potrebno.
Kada biste trebali verziju svog API-ja?
Kada je broj korisnika API-ja mali (ili nula), ili kada su potrošači interni i možete lako koordinirati promjene API-ja, tada utjecaj može biti minimizirana. Ipak, svaka promjena koju zahtijeva API potrošač košta vremena i truda. Kao rezultat toga, stvaranje nove verzije vašeg API-ja trebalo bi biti posljednje sredstvo.
Zašto biste trebali verziju svog API-ja?
Kada je broj korisnika API-ja mali (ili nula), ili kada su potrošači interni i možete lako koordinirati promjene API-ja, tada utjecaj može biti minimizirana. Ipak, svaka promjena koju zahtijeva API potrošač košta vremena i truda. Kao rezultat toga, stvaranje nove verzije vašeg API-ja trebalo bi biti posljednje sredstvo.
Je li verzija API-ja loša?
Zašto je API Verzija je loša Izgradnja API-ja traje puno vremena i košta puno, a isto tako i njegovo verzioniranje. … Morat ćete se suočiti sa zbunjenošću i nezadovoljstvom programera, jer ažuriranje njihovog koda ili prebacivanje API-ja ne zvuči zabavno.
Je li API verzija dobra praksa?
Upravljanje verzijama API-ja je potrebno jer osigurava stabilnost i pouzdanost Ako ne instalirate ispravno verziju API-ja, to može imati katastrofalne učinke na daljnje proizvode i usluge. Kao i svaka druga tehnologija, API-ji su međusobno povezani i za funkcioniranje se oslanjaju na različite sustave, softver i baze podataka.